Strategy & play
How Lurantis plays — derived from its stats and the rules of the game, not an opinion.
- Hits for 130 — one-shots small Basics and support Pokémon, but trades down into the format’s big attackers.
- Needs Grass Energy to attack — your line must supply that color.
- Grass type, weak to Fire ×2 — a Fire attacker doing ≥60 effectively one-shots it.
- A single-prize attacker — prize-trade-positive against ex / V decks that give up two at a time.
- A Stage 1 — one step up from Fomantis; doesn’t help your opening hand, but quick to set up.
- Currently Standard-legal — usable in the main rotating format.
How to beat Lurantis
- Exploit its Fire weakness — ≥60 damage one-shots it.
- Gust it before the evolution is set up.

Frequently asked
How can I tell if my Lurantis is real?
Lurantis is not on our list of commonly-counterfeited cards, but counterfeits exist across every set. Check the back-light test (real cards have a black inner layer that blocks light; counterfeits glow through), the rosette dot pattern on the back under magnification, font weight and kerning on the card name, and the holofoil pattern if applicable. For high-value copies we recommend submitting to a professional grader (PSA, BGS, CGC) for tamper-evident authentication.
